S.T.O.P. Condemns Hochul's $700k Social Media Surveillance 'Gimmick'
November 17, 2023
NEW YORK, Nov. 17 -- The Surveillance Technology Oversight Project issued the following news release on Nov. 16, 2023:

Today, the Surveillance Technology Oversight Project (S.T.O.P.), a New York-based privacy and civil rights group, condemns New York Governor Kathy Hochul's expansion of New York State Police social media surveillance as a "gimmick," not a real public safety response.
